本文实例讲述了C#彩色图片灰度化实现方法。分享给大家供大家参考。具体方法如下:
主要功能代码如下:
代码如下:public static Bitmap MakeGrayscale(Bitmap original)
{
//create a blank bitmap the same size as original
Bitmap newBitmap = new Bitmap(original.Width, original.Height);
//get a graphi
本文实例讲述了C#数字图象处理之图像灰度化方法。分享给大家供大家参考。具体如下:
//定义图像灰度化函数
private static Bitmap PGray(Bitmap src)
{
int w = src.Width;
int h = src.Height;
//构建与原图像大小一样的模版图像
Bitmap dstBitmap = new Bitmap(src.Width, src.Height, System.Drawing.Imaging.PixelFormat.For